Cash Bonuses Planned for Dell Executives

Dell Computer Corp.,which has been slashing employee stock options, plan to pay cash bonuses to top executives.

> > Dell board of directors approved bonuses last month and will ask shareholders to give their approval. Board members said the five year bonus plan would help Dell attract and keep qualified executives.
Dell officials cut the number of stock options granted to employees by about half.
Stock options are still a part of compensation for Dell employees but the company believes that reducing the reliance on options will result in more attractive compensation packages.
In the SEC filing Dell said MIchael Dell was paid $950,000 salary and $2.5 million bonus in 2002, compared to $347,000 bonus in 2001. President/COO Kevin B. Rollins was paid $771,000 salary and $2 million bonus in 2002, compared to $243.000 bonus in 2001. Each also received options for 500,000 shares.

Source: The Nando Times article dated May 6, 2003
